On Saturday, May 11th, more than 5,000 fighters and supporters participated in the in the 10th annual CT Breast Cancer Initiative Race at Walnut Hill Park in New Britain. The walk/run raised money for breast cancer research and to support those who are still fighting. The money also goes towards breast cancer education PayHub’s Alan Nathan and Austin Peterson walked with their family, Merri and Ariel Nathan, along with the KP Cares group of King Phillip Middle School from West Hartford. Last October, PayHub raised $730 for breast cancer research, and we will be raising money again this year.
